Schengen — updated.
Bulgaria is now a full Schengen member (air/sea from March 2024; land from January 2025). Older charter guidance saying otherwise is out of date.

Sofia flights draw on Bulgarian sourcing — shopska salad and banitsa, superb yoghurt and white cheese, Rose Valley products, Bulgarian wines (a serious and underrated industry), grilled meats — with restaurant and lodge sourcing on request and special diets on 24-hour lead.
